The cybersecurity landscape is constantly evolving with new threats emerging regularly. Staying informed about these changes is essential for protecting sensitive data.
Recent trends indicate a rise in threats such as AI-driven attacks, deepfakes, and advanced persistent threats (APTs). Each of these poses unique challenges and risks to data security.
To counter emerging threats, organizations must adopt proactive prevention techniques, including threat intelligence, anomaly detection, and regular security assessments.
An effective incident response plan is crucial for mitigating the impact of cyber threats. Organizations should prepare for potential incidents by developing clear response protocols and conducting regular drills.
Continuous monitoring of cybersecurity trends and threats allows organizations to adapt their strategies and remain resilient against potential risks.
As cyber threats continue to evolve, staying ahead of the curve is critical. By understanding emerging threats and implementing effective prevention techniques, organizations can better safeguard their data.
